The Controversy Behind The Determination Of The Actual Speed Camera Location
Over the past few years, many cities have seen a number of changes on the roads
.
Speed camera location have been strategically placed in order to make sure that people stop speeding excessively on the highways as well as the local roads. While the officials who approved these installations claim that these cameras are designed to keep everyone on the roads safe, there is some speculation about the amount of money that these cameras bring in each year.
These cameras are usually placed around the popular intersections as well as the long stretched of highway where speeders are most likely found. There seems to be some debate on the placement of these cameras and some cities often have to go months in order to allow everyone on the planning committee to have their say. There is a lot of time and work that does go into installing these cameras. Typically, areas with the most accidents or speeding ticket results is going to get a camera installed.
The long stretches of the road where people like to cruise through at 80 miles an hour or higher will have a camera installed. When the speeder goes 10 miles over the speed limit, they will be flashed once they cross over the sensors that have been installed in the road. The flash is a camera that is taking a picture of the person who is driving as well as the license plate number on the back and front of the vehicle.
There is some good that comes from these cameras. Rather than having a police officer posted at a speed trap spot, the cameras will do all of the work. This should actually decrease the amount of crime in areas with these cameras simply because the police will be able to police the streets a lot better. The cameras are not all about the money that they are making each and every year.
When these cameras are installed, they are aimed at the street a certain way. If aimed the wrong way, the camera might be triggered numerous times. It is very important that these cameras are installed and aimed in the right direction so that accurate information is collected.
In the state of California, there have been some
speed camera scams that have been uncovered. Arizona had an issue with people putting bags and cardboard boxes over the cameras so that they could not take pictures. There seems to be a lot of tampering with these cameras that goes to show that many people simply do not want them. Some states are even trying to make more money than they should be, which is one of the reasons why these questions are coming about.
One thing is for certain, these speed cameras do bring in a great amount of money each year. Some states have reported bringing in millions in revenue each year from tickets sent out to drivers. This is one of the biggest problems that people have with the cameras, simply because making money from these cameras is simply not right.
The speed camera location could depend on where the state could make the most money. However, there is still some debate about the cameras being put in for the safety of the drivers on the road. One thing is for certain, these cameras are here to stay and more are definitely coming.
